High-Output Mag-Drive Pump for Ponds Up to 15,000 Litres
The Aquascape EcoWave 4000 is a high-output mag-drive submersible pond and waterfall pump rated at 4,000 GPH (15,141 LPH) and drawing only 130 watts. As the largest model in the EcoWave range, it provides substantial circulation capacity for large water gardens and waterfalls while maintaining the magnetic drive's inherent advantages of low noise, high efficiency, and long service life compared to conventional motor pump designs.
Professional-Level Flow With Residential Energy Consumption
Conventional pumps at the 4,000 GPH output level typically require 250 to 350 watts to operate. The EcoWave 4000's 130-watt draw delivers a meaningful reduction in annual operating cost, which for a continuously running pond pump translates to substantial savings over a full season. The maximum head height of 6.1 m (20 ft) provides the pressure needed for tall waterfall installations common in larger water garden designs.

How to Use
Install the EcoWave 4000 fully submerged in a pond skimmer or on the pond floor. Connect the 2-inch MPT discharge to the waterfall or biological filter plumbing using a compatible elbow and hose barb. Plug the 6 m cord into a GFCI-protected outdoor outlet. For waterfalls with heads above 4 m (13 ft), expect reduced flow at the outlet and confirm the resulting flow rate is sufficient for the waterfall weir width. Clean the intake screen every two to four weeks. In freezing climates, remove and store indoors over winter.
Ideal for large koi ponds and water gardens between 11,000 and 15,000 litres (3,000 to 4,000 gal) with waterfalls up to 5 m (16 ft) high, where quiet, energy-efficient circulation is important to the owner.
